100 Years of QEII: Official UK 2026 Queen Elizabeth II Mary Gillick £5 Coin Pack
2026 marks 100 years since the birth of Queen Elizabeth II. To celebrate this historic occasion, The Royal Mint has introduced a new £5 coin series, each featuring one of the five official portraits of Her Late Majesty that reflect her remarkable reign spanning seven decades.
The first coin in the collection highlights Mary Gillick’s youthful effigy, first seen on circulating coinage in 1953. This timeless portrait has been carefully remastered by Gordon Summers, Chief Engraver at The Royal Mint, to honour the beginning of Queen Elizabeth II’s extraordinary story.

Specifications
- Country of Issue: UK
- Year of Issue: 2026
- Coin Diameter: 38.61mm
- Coin Weight: 28.28g
- Obverse: Martin Jennings
- Reverse: Gordon Summers
- Metal: Curpro-nickel
- Finish: Brilliant Uncirculated
